Ken and I plan on escorting a new voyage that is about to be announced. I did send out a flyer that it might happen but now I know it is happening. Doing this post in case you missed the flyer.
This all came up at an event Silversea hosted. They were considering doing what I have always wanted and never understood why they did not do it. . A trip to Antarctica that only included South Georgia and Antarctica. Usually expeditions add 3 - 4 days in the Falklands. These are expensive cruises and although the Falklands are good it just increases the cost so much and the jewels are South Georgia and Antarctica. Whether to do this or not was being discussed and I shared that I thought it was a fantastic idea. It may or may not happen again.
A trip to Antarctica without South Georgia usually means people have to go back to see South Georgia. To me South Georgia it is the JEWEL of the trip. This is where you see the KING penguins the larger species you will not see in Antarctica.
They are doing this trip on the SILVER CLOUD. The ship has been refurbished and has a reinforced hull and is super luxury onboard. When onboard I could not wrap my head around the fact it was an expedition ship. Plus new zodiacs that I think will be a huge improvement in ride and ease of getting on and off.
Dates will most likely be January 4 to 19, 2020. Perfect time frame for this trip for weather and Penguins.
